Abstract

The application belongs to the technical field of glass raw material mixing, and particularly relates to a glass raw material high-efficiency mixing machine integrated with unloading scrapers, which comprises a mixing machine body, a support seat is fixedly connected to the bottom of the mixing machine body, a plurality of unloading scrapers with parallelogram cross sections and inclinations are arranged, stronger shearing force and stirring force can be generated in the rotating process, the agglomeration and stratification of the raw materials can be effectively broken, the plurality of unloading scrapers are stirred with high power by the output end of a servo motor, so that the glass raw materials with different densities and particle sizes can be fully mixed in the mixing machine body, when the mixing is completed, the plurality of unloading scrapers are arranged in a cross and separated manner, the materials in the mixing machine body are continuously scraped along a plurality of circular tracks in the interior of the mixing machine body, the uniformly mixed materials can be smoothly discharged through the connected unloading port and discharge port, and the problems of uneven mixing and material adhesion of the traditional glass raw material mixing machine are solved.

Description

Technical Field

[0001] This invention belongs to the field of glass raw material mixing technology, specifically a high-efficiency glass raw material mixer with an integrated unloading scraper. Background Technology

[0002] Glass is an amorphous solid, mainly composed of silicates. It is typically transparent, hard, and chemically stable. Its manufacturing process begins with precise raw material proportions. The core process involves mixing the main raw materials, such as quartz sand, soda ash, and limestone, with auxiliary materials according to a formula. Subsequently, the mixture is fed into a melting furnace to melt and transform into a homogeneous molten glass. After the molten glass undergoes clarification, homogenization, and cooling to reach a suitable state for forming, it is then shaped using processes such as float glass, blowing, pressing, and drawing. Finally, the formed glass products must undergo a carefully controlled annealing process to eliminate internal stress and ensure their strength and durability, ultimately being processed into various glass products.

[0003] In glassmaking, raw material mixing is a crucial step that determines the uniformity of glass composition and final quality. This step is not a simple physical stirring process, but rather a uniform mixing of the main raw materials, such as quartz sand, soda ash, and limestone, which constitute a very large proportion of the formula, with auxiliary raw materials such as clarifying agents and colorants, which are used in very small amounts but play a vital role. The core objective is to achieve a high degree of dispersion and uniform distribution of each component, forming a batch with a highly consistent chemical composition. This uniformity is directly related to the subsequent melting speed, the homogeneity of the molten glass, and the lifespan of the melting furnace, and ultimately affects all key performance indicators of the glass, such as transparency, strength, and color.

[0004] Traditional glass raw material mixers, especially drum mixers, have long been the mainstream equipment used in the industry. The main body is a rotating metal cylinder, which is usually equipped with lifting blades. During operation, the cylinder rotates at a constant speed under the drive of a motor. After the raw materials are lifted to a certain height inside the cylinder, they are scattered, diffused, and slide off each other under the action of gravity, thereby achieving mixing. When discharging, traditional glass raw material mixers mainly use a tilting drum. After the materials are mixed, the drive device pushes the entire drum to rotate forward, and the materials inside the drum are discharged from the discharge port at the front of the drum under the action of gravity. This type of equipment has a robust structure, large processing capacity, and relatively simple maintenance.

[0005] In glass manufacturing, although the aforementioned traditional glass raw material mixer can perform conventional mixing and unloading of glass raw materials, its mixing principle is gravity diffusion type. This means that it mainly relies on gravity and the rotation of the drum to mix and unload the materials. When dealing with raw materials with large differences in density and particle size, light and heavy materials are prone to separate during the mixing process, resulting in stratified distribution and uneven material mixing. Consequently, it is difficult to meet the requirements of glass production for uniform mixing.

[0025] The discharge scraper has a parallelogram cross-sectional shape and is inclined, or it can be a curved scraper. During the glass raw material mixing process, because the discharge scraper 18 has a parallelogram cross-sectional shape and is inclined, its vertical cross-section along the direction of movement shows that the discharge scraper 18 is inclined, with its inclination reference being the central vertical axis of the mixer body. It is also tilted to the side relative to the bottom surface of the mixer body, with an inclination angle set between 30° and 45°. This enhances shearing and stirring forces during rotation, resolving the mixing issues between raw materials. In cases of agglomeration and stratification, multiple discharge scrapers 18, driven by the high-power and efficient agitation of the glass raw materials by the output of the servo motor 13, form a continuous oblique shearing surface when rotating. This changes the trajectory of the material movement and produces a layering and peeling effect, achieving shearing and dispersion. This ensures that glass raw materials of different densities and particle sizes are fully mixed within the mixer body 1. At the same time, the special structural design of the discharge scrapers 18 can reduce the adhesion of materials to the bottom surface during the mixing process, reduce the generation of mixing dead corners, and further improve the uniformity of mixing. like Figures 8 to 11As shown, when mixing multi-component glass raw materials with large density differences (such as quartz sand, soda ash, sodium sulfate, limestone, and dolomite), a curved discharge scraper 18 can be installed on the fixed rod 17. The scraping surface of the curved discharge scraper 18 is set as an S-shaped twisted surface, which has a continuous and gradually changing curved surface structure in space. In the vertical direction, the upper part of the curved discharge scraper 18 is thinner and the lower part is thicker, and the upper part is set as a sloping transition structure. In the horizontal direction, the two sides of the curved discharge scraper 18 are thinner and the middle part is thicker, forming a twisted structure that is thick in the center and thin on both sides. In the working state, the servo motor 13 drives the turntable 14 to make the curved discharge scraper 18 move in a circular motion around the central axis of the mixer body 1. Since the scraping surface of the curved discharge scraper 18 is an S-shaped twisted surface, during the movement, the surface of the curved discharge scraper 18 generates a continuously changing positive thrust and lateral component force between itself and the material, which can effectively handle materials with different densities. The material of the same density achieves differentiated movement. The low-density material is scooped up by the S-shaped curved surface, while the high-density material is guided and pushed tangentially by the S-shaped curved surface. This creates a multi-directional and multi-layered mixing effect inside the mixer body 1, reducing the sedimentation and accumulation of high-density material at the bottom of the machine and ensuring the uniformity of mixing of multi-component material. In addition, the thin upper and thin sides of the curved discharge scraper 18 result in a smaller contact surface with the material during rotation. The material can easily slide naturally along the slope and thin area, reducing the adhesion of material to the scraper surface. At the same time, the thickened middle of the curved discharge scraper 18 ensures the overall structural strength and rigidity, ensuring that it is not easily deformed during long-term high-load mixing. Compared with the parallelogram cross-section discharge scraper 18, the curved discharge scraper 18 can specifically adapt to the mixing needs of multi-component glass raw materials with large density differences, improving the mixing effect and discharge smoothness.

[0028] like Figures 1 to 5 As shown, two agitator plates 4 are fixedly attached to the multiple fixed rods 17. The agitator plates 4 have horn holes and are located above the discharge scraper 18. When the discharge scraper 18 at the bottom of the fixed rods 17 mixes the glass raw material with the output of the servo motor 13, the agitator plates 4 are located above the fixed rods 17 and above the discharge scraper 18. The agitator plates 4 agitate the material through the horn holes on their surfaces. The material can enter from the large opening of the horn hole and then exit from the small opening. The horn holes divert, turbulent, and pre-disperse the material, reducing material agglomeration. The two agitator plates 4 also agitate the glass raw material with the fixed rods 17. The multiple horn holes on the two agitator plates 4, combined with the edges of their surfaces, uniformly and efficiently disperse the glass raw material during the agitation process. In addition, the two agitator plates 4 are located above the discharge scraper 18 and cooperate with the discharge scraper 18 to form a three-dimensional stirring structure, enhancing the mixing effect of the mixer.

[0029] Multiple dispersing rods 5 are fixedly connected to the bottom of the multiple connecting frames 16, with four dispersing rods 5 forming a group, and each group of dispersing rods 5 is fixed between the connecting rod 15 and the fixed rod 17. When the connecting frame 16 rotates with the output end of the servo motor 13, the dispersing rods 5 are located at the bottom of the connecting frame 16 and between the unloading scraper 18 and the stirring plate 4. The multiple dispersing rods 5 can stir near the center of the bottom of the connecting frame 16, powerfully crushing and uniformly dispersing the middle layer material, eliminating large particle agglomerates. The multiple dispersing rods 5 are fixed to the bottom of the connecting frame 16 and rotate synchronously. During the rotation of the multiple dispersing rods 5, the glass raw material is dispersed. The dispersing effect of the stirring plate 4 and the multiple dispersing rods 5 cooperates with the shearing and stirring effect of the unloading scraper 18, and the three form a synergistic effect of upper layer pre-dispersion, middle layer dispersion and lower layer shearing and scraping. The pre-dispersion generated by the horn-shaped holes provides looser material conditions for the dispersing rods. The dispersing effect of the dispersing rods provides a more uniform material base for the unloading scraper. The shearing and pushing action of the unloading scraper then flips the bottom material upwards, improving the mixing effect. The glass raw materials are processed from different angles and positions, allowing the agglomerates in the raw materials to be broken up more thoroughly, thus improving the uniformity of the mixture. Moreover, every four dispersing rods 5 are fixed together between the connecting rod 15 and the fixed rod 17. This layout ensures that there are enough dispersing rods 5 to disperse the raw materials in multiple areas inside the mixer, reducing the generation of dead zones in the mixing process. This ensures that the glass raw materials in different positions can be fully and uniformly mixed, thereby improving the quality and efficiency of glass raw material mixing and meeting the high requirements for raw material mixing in the glass production process.

[0030] like Figures 1 to 4As shown, three scraper blades 6 are fixedly connected to the turntable 14. The cross-sectional shape of the scraper blades 6 is triangular, and one side of the scraper blades 6 is attached to the inner wall of the mixer body 1. When a large amount of glass raw material is mixed in the mixer body 1, some glass raw material is prone to adhere to the inner wall of the mixer body 1. With the three scraper blades 6 evenly distributed on the turntable 14, as the output end of the servo motor 13 drives the turntable 14 and the three scraper blades 6 to rotate, the three scraper blades 6 with triangular cross-sections can effectively scrape off the attached glass raw material while adhering to the inner wall of the mixer body 1 during the rotation process, and guide the scraped glass raw material away from the inner wall of the mixer body 1 to be added to the mixture, reducing the uneven mixing phenomenon caused by the adhesion of raw material during the mixing process, and further improving the uniformity of the mixture. In addition, the three scraper blades 6 are evenly distributed on the turntable 14, so that all areas of the inner wall of the mixer body 1 can be effectively scraped, reducing the generation of mixing dead corners and improving the overall mixing effect of the mixer.

[0031] Multiple scraper plates 6 are fixedly connected to their bottom ends with guide blocks 7; one side of the guide block 7 is set as a slope, and the bottom end of the guide block 7 is attached to the inner bottom surface of the mixer body 1; when some glass raw materials accumulate in the inner wall angle of the mixer body 1 during the mixing process and affect the mixing, the guide block 7 is fixed to the bottom of the scraper plate 6 and is attached to the inner wall angle of the mixer body 1. As the multiple scraper plates 6 rotate to scrape the attached material inside the mixer body 1, the guide block 7 also scrapes the material in the inner wall angle of the mixer body 1. One side of the guide block 7 is set as a slope, and its shape is similar to an agricultural plow. During the process, it can plow up the material piled up in the corner of the inner wall of the mixer body 1 and guide it to the mixing area, so that the material that was originally difficult to participate in the mixing can return to the mixing process, further improving the uniformity of mixing and reducing the problem of insufficient mixing caused by material accumulation in the corner. At the same time, the bottom end of the guide block 7 is closely attached to the inner bottom surface of the mixer body 1. During the rotation, it can also scrape off the material attached to the inner bottom surface of the mixer body 1, avoiding material residue on the bottom surface, ensuring the comprehensive mixing and efficient discharge of materials inside the mixer, and improving the overall performance and use effect of the mixer.
